Gay flamingos???? Hate to burst that bubble, but one of them had to copulate with a bird of the opposite sex in order to hatch a chick, duh. Also, it's not unusual for flamingos to raise chicks cooperatively, as they live in large colonies. As for producing milk "in their throats," all flamingos secrete a substance from their upper digestive tract that is called "crop milk," to feed their chicks.
